Remote Data Mining And Management Job In Data Science And Analytics

Automatization of Excel data feeding via VBA/VBScript or other Language

Find more Data Mining And Management remote jobs posted recently Worldwide

Dear expert,

Set up:
A sqlite3 database (DB) is updated each morning at 5am via Python-coded datascraping from web and other API sources. In order to perform calculations I use Microsoft Excel and then import the data as KPIs back into the DB. The source files are financial statements of public companies (Income statement, balance sheet and the cash flow statement in annual and quarterly version - in total 6 csv files per company). I have 2 excel files , called CPA and XXX_kpi (which is in the specific format required for my sqlite3 DB).

1. My main excel workbook (called CPA) (which calculates the KPIs) needs to
a. be opened in the background or (if easier) each time when I run a macro - if the computer/excel is blocked during this time no problem - I need to do this only once each month
b. Create a VB script which will feed data into Sheets: MStar IS, MStar BS, MStar CF, MStar Q_IS, MStar Q_BS, MStar Q_CF - always in cells CD$12:$AQ$238 (GREEN marked) for all 6 csv sheets
c. Keep the data/year which are outdated, adjust green arean, e.g. in 2020, extend 1 column
D.Compile data from respective sheet and save with the name of a specific cell in this workbook (e.g.NYSE.DE) in a specific folder and close

2. In a dedicated folder I have an import file for each company (e.g. NYSE.DE_kpi) which is currently pulling the KPIs via powerquery from 2 sheets in the CPA file (Export). This workbook needs to be
a. be opened in the background or (if easier) each time when I run a macro - if the computer/excel is blocked during this time no problem - I need to do this only once each month) - you may integrate this macro into the first one (if possible?)
b. Save and close as a normal workbook

3. (Optional) There are 2 power queries in the sheet which are linked to the sqlite3 database via odbc - the 2 data connections are called Prices and Dividends - it would be fantastic if you could write a code how to refer successfully refer to a cell within the query SQL (e.g. DE.US is cell Cockpit!M12)

I will share the files & file structure of my local computer with shortlisted candidates.

Please ask any question and quote a fixed price.

Thanks a lot - looking forward working with you.
About the recuiter
Member since Nov 11, 2022
Radheshyam Kumar
from England, United Kingdom

Skills & Expertise Required

Data Science & Analytics Data Mining & Management 

Open for hiringApply before - May 26, 2024

Work from Anywhere

40 hrs / week

Hourly Type

Remote Job

$26.83

Cost

Offer to work on this project closes in 7 days!
Are you interested in this Opportunity?

Looking for help? Checkout our video tutorial
How to search and apply for jobs

How to apply? Do you have more questions about the Job?
See frequently asked questions

Similar Projects

Position data export from FlightAware using FlightAware API to URL endpoint f

We need to provide our aircraft global position information from the onboard satellite positioning system to a spatially enable system called CATS. The position information currently is uploaded to FlightAware for presentation. FlightAware has an...read more

Data Cleanup, Segmentation and Engineering

We have data that needs to be cleaned up, segmented and made ready to be marketed to. Needless to say, we only want to work with someone who can sign an NDA and ensure confidentiality of data. Web scraping will be an advantage. Data currently is of 2...read more

Document parser tool (.doc, .pdf)

I need a PDF parser tool to integrate with my website. It needs to be capable of parsing CV/resume data.
Data needs to be organised in categories: experience entries, education entries, skills, picture, etc.
The tool needs to be capable of pa...read more